Somerset countys des handles dispatch for 8 fire companies, 2 ems companies and 3 police agencies along the east shore of the chesapeake bay, while worcester countys 911 center dispatches 9 out of the 10 fire companies and 6 out of 7 ambulance companies in that county. When an emergency situation occurs and public safety assistance is required, the professional men and women working in the public prince georges public safety communications 911 center are trained to ensure the timely dispatch of police, fire, ems or sheriff personnel to the emergency.
